Aim
The aim of this foundation course is to provide learners with a basic knowledge and understanding of economic theories and their underlying implications for the smooth running of a country’s economic system. It is in 2 parts. The first part pertains to the micro elements, i.e. behaviour of individuals, firms and role of the state and the second part focuses on the economy in the global world and discusses more in-depth issues related to macro economics and the development of a country.

OUfc008111-Foundation in Economics I
- Unit 1: Basic Economic Ideas
- Unit 2: The Price System
- Unit 3: Government intervention in the price system
- Unit 4: International Trade
OUfc008121-Foundation in Economics II
- Unit 5: Money, Employment and unemployment, labour & wages
- Unit 6: Consumer behavior and the theory of the firm
- Unit 7: National income statistics and measurement in the macro economy
- Unit 8: Economic growth and macro-economic policies
